What to know about ZIP 99835

ZIP code 99835 covers Sitka, AK in Sitka City and Borough with a population of about 8,393.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 39.6 (near the U.S. median).

It sits in telephone area code 907; U.S. House district AK-00.

Income and economy in Sitka, AK

Median household income in ZIP 99835 is about $101,207 — about 35% above the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 8.4%; unemployment rate near 7.1%; 34.4%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(roughly in line with the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Healthcare, Public administration, and Retail trade; about 7.9%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 7.3 points below the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 180.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 99835

Median home value is about $442,100 — about 27% above the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show median gross rent around $1,095 (about 6% below the U.S. median rent ($1,163)), and owner-occupancy near 61.7% (about 3.7 points below the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).

To comfortably buy a median-priced home in ZIP 99835 in Sitka, AK, a household would need roughly $122,000 in annual income under a 20% down, 30-year loan at 6.8% (illustrative), keeping housing costs near 28% of income. Estimated monthly PITI is about $2,840. That is about 21% above the local median household income ($101,207), so the median earner would likely stretch or need a larger down payment. Rates, taxes, insurance, and HOA fees vary — treat this as a planning estimate, not a lender quote.
